IT professionals, system administrators, business owners, and decision-makers are responsible for managing Linux servers and ensuring their security and reliability.
To provide a thorough guide on the best practices, tools, and strategies for backup, security, and maintenance of Linux servers, helping organizations safeguard their data and optimize server performance.
Outline:
- Introduce the critical importance of Linux servers in various industries.
- Highlight the challenges of managing Linux server environments, especially concerning data loss, security threats, and system performance.
- State the purpose of the article: to explore effective backup, security, and maintenance services for Linux servers.
Understanding the Importance of Backup
- Explain the risks of data loss and the implications for businesses.
- Discuss different types of backups:
- Full, incremental, and differential backups.
- Offsite vs. onsite backups.
- Emphasize the role of regular backups in disaster recovery planning.
- Provide statistics or case studies illustrating the impact of data loss on businesses.
Best Practices for Linux Server Backup
- Outline best practices for implementing a robust backup strategy:
- Determining backup frequency based on data volatility.
- Selecting appropriate backup tools (e.g.,
rsync
,tar
, commercial solutions). - Implementing automated backup processes.
- Ensuring data integrity and verifying backups regularly.
- Establishing a backup retention policy to balance data accessibility and storage costs.
- Discuss the importance of documentation and training for team members involved in backup procedures.
Enhancing Security for Linux Servers
- Discuss the primary security threats facing Linux servers (e.g., malware, unauthorized access, DDoS attacks).
- Provide actionable security measures:
- Implementing firewalls and intrusion detection/prevention systems (IDS/IPS).
- Configuring SSH for secure remote access.
- Regularly applying security patches and updates.
- Utilizing security best practices for user management (e.g., least privilege, strong passwords).
- Encrypting sensitive data both at rest and in transit.
- Mention compliance considerations (e.g., GDPR, HIPAA) and their impact on server security.
Routine Maintenance for Linux Servers
- Explain the importance of regular maintenance for optimal server performance.
- Discuss key maintenance tasks:
- Monitoring system performance (CPU, memory, disk space).
- Cleaning up temporary files and logs.
- Conducting system updates and upgrades.
- Testing backup restoration processes.
- Provide tools and commands that can assist in maintenance (e.g.,
cron
,top
,df
).
Case Studies on Backup, Security, and Maintenance Services
- Present case studies showcasing organizations that effectively implemented backup, security, and maintenance services for their Linux servers.
- Highlight challenges faced, solutions deployed, and outcomes achieved.
- Include quotes or testimonials from IT professionals or business owners involved in the case studies.
Choosing the Right Services and Tools
- Discuss considerations for selecting backup, security, and maintenance services:
- Assessing the organization’s needs and budget.
- Evaluating different service providers and their offerings.
- Understanding the importance of scalability and support.
- Provide a brief overview of popular tools and service providers in the market.
- Summarize the key points discussed throughout the article.
- Reinforce the importance of comprehensive backup, security, and maintenance strategies for Linux servers.
- Encourage readers to evaluate their current practices and consider implementing the strategies outlined to enhance their server reliability and security.